Output 589766e233c93995bdc7335c56b4fb52f59147f50ee88e38654600af99b975eb:10

value
99896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 568e6e0532ea91ec71ea789827d8bed8e52d0e70 OP_EQUALVERIFY OP_CHECKSIG
address
18tfjh5tKoRTCfxt64NMyCLAZWduGUsFkk
transaction
589766e233c93995bdc7335c56b4fb52f59147f50ee88e38654600af99b975eb